LSCS (Cesarean Section)
A Cesarean section (LSCS) is a surgical method of childbirth recommended when vaginal delivery poses a risk to the mother or baby. It is planned in advance or performed in emergencies with complete care and sterile precautions.
What It Includes:
- Preoperative evaluation and anesthesia planning
- Surgical delivery of the baby through abdominal incision
- Post-operative monitoring and wound care
- Pain management and recovery support
- Breastfeeding assistance post-surgery
Advantages:
- Ensures safety in high-risk or emergency situations
- Can be planned for convenience and medical necessity
- Reduces trauma during complicated deliveries
